Security Essentials for Airdrop Hunters

Protect your assets while airdrop farming:
1. Always verify contract addresses via official project Twitter/Discord
2. Never share seed phrases – legitimate airdrops never request them
3. Use dedicated wallets separate from main holdings
4. Enable transaction simulation in Braavos wallet to preview outcomes
5. Beware of fake “claim now” websites – bookmark official portals only
